Overview

Tangle Tower is a masterclass in character-driven mystery, blending vibrant hand-drawn art with clever clue-linking mechanics and witty dialogue. These recommendations focus on games that prioritize deduction, charming visual styles, and deep investigative narratives, ensuring you find the same sense of discovery and personality found in the halls of Tangle Tower.
